Addisyn Whiting missing one year
Today is the first anniversary of the disappearance of Addisyn Marie Whiting. She was abducted by her non-custodial mother, Tamara Wilson, from Pensacola, Florida. They may have traveled to Montgomery or Selma, Alabama.
